Transaction 5e30dcbde4d2d71bdd50e344ec8c9a0c1274e159b95fc301d807431b03bc2b8d

3 Input
1 Outputs
  • 5e30dcbde4d2d71bdd50e344ec8c9a0c1274e159b95fc301d807431b03bc2b8d:0
  • value  48448075
    address  3BRpfecfDp2EfdNN76rPGDcd5oKvBzYQhy